Injured ankle during the Master 1000 in Miami, the Briton canceled his participation in the tournaments in Monte-Carlo and Munich.

While he made a good comeback against Tomas Machac in the third round of the Master 1000 in Miami (5-7, 7-5, 7-6), the Scot was seriously injured by partially rupturing his calcaneofibular ligament .

While the exact duration of his absence has not been communicated, his team has stated that Andy Murray “made the decision to miss the Rolex Monte Carlo Masters and the BMW Open Munich”. On the other hand, the former world number 1 expresses his desire to participate in Roland-Garros.

Aged 36, Andy Murray is probably playing his last year on the international circuit. Wimbledon and the Olympics remain his main goals.
